Add a photo
dinehere.us
HOME
Review
Village Inn Cape Cod Photos
Village Inn Cape Cod Photo Galleries
‹
›
Village Inn Cape Cod Photo Galleries
‹
›
×
Click on a Thumbnail.
Pictures of Village Inn Cape Cod on 92 MA-6A, Yarmouth Port MA.
(Click on a thumbnail to enlarge picture)
Searching...
Let's find
Restaurants
near your location